System.out.println(“left recursive”);} else. System.out.println(“non left recursive”); }} OUTPUT. Enter number of production 2 Enter Non-Teminals of left production A A Enter Non-Teminals/terminals of right production Ad g The productions are: A–>Ad A–>g. grammer left recursive
Sep 11, 2018 · [code]#include<stdio.h> #include<string.h> int main() { int i,j,k; int n,m; char str[100]; scanf("%s",&str); i=0, j=strlen(str)-1; while(i<j) { if(str[i]!=str[j ...
Write a function that will return true if its argument (you may use either a C-String or std::string) is a palindrome. Use a recursive algorithm to make the determination. You will likely need to create additional "helper" and utility functions to support your algorithm; feel free to do so.
How to Check Palindrome in C# Using Various Methods? Till now, we have checked only numbers which are a palindrome. But let me tell you we can check this with string also. Because of some combination of strings also has nature like a palindrome. Example #1 – Madam. Let’s take this string madam and reverse it and we will find the same string.
Palindrome. Palindromes can be read in both directions. A palindrome has the same letters on both ends of the string. It is a form of word puzzle.
Oct 31, 2015 · The simple meaning of recursion is the repeated application of any procedure.And if talk in context of programming then recursion is to call a method repeatedly or use call the function by itself.And we can't say that using of recursive call may always going to improve the performance.It depends on how the recursion call is made.Here in our program we are going to use tail recursive call.
18.7 Examples: palindrome. Enough technical examples! Let’s try a little puzzle. A palindrome is a word that is spelled the same from both ends. For example, anna, petep, and malayalam are palindromes, whereas ida and homesick are not. There are two basic ways of determining whether a word is a palindrome:
3.1 Solving a Problem Using Recursion A palindrome is a string that is the same backward and forward: "rats live on no evil star” or single words such as “civic” or “deed” are palindromes. In this activity you will design and implement a recursive function that determines whether or not a given string is a palindrome.
I have written this code and it is supposed to tell us if the string entered is a palindrome. it must be done using recursion and it needs to use a string reverse function and it hasto be written in .c I dont know where i am going wrong with this.
Aug 26, 2016 · A Watson-Crick complemented palindrome is a DNA string that is equal to the complement (A-T, C-G) of its reverse. Watson-Crick complement. Write a function that takes as input a DNA string of A, C, G, and T characters and returns the string in reverse order with all of characters replaced by their complements.
Problem : A palindrome is a sequence of characters or numbers that looks the same forwards and backwards. For example, "Madam, I'm Adam" is a palindrome because it is spelled the same reading it from front to back as from back to front. The number 12321 is a numerical palindrome.
Oct 16, 2018 · Recursive Apporach A recursive function is a function that: Includes a call to itself, Has a stopping condition to stop the recursion. For our recursive A word, phrase, or sequence that reads the same backwards as forwards, e.g. madam.For this challenge we will investigate two algorithms used to find out if a word is a palindrome or not.
Palindrome Palindrome is a String that equals itself when reversed: "racecar" "abba" "12321" Write a recursive method that returns true if a given string is a palindrome What is/are the base case(s)? What is the recursive case?
A Palindrome Number is a number that even when reversed is same as original number Examples of Palindrome Number 121, 393, 34043, 111, 555, 48084 Examples of Palindrome Numb.
Recursion is the process of repeating items in a self-similar way. In programming languages, if a program Following is an example to find palindrome of a given number using recursive function.
Palindrome Number Program in C++ A Palindrome number is a number that remains the same when its digits are reversed. Like 16461, for example: we take 121 and reverse it, after revers it is same as original.
A palindrome string is one that reads the same backward as well as forward. It can be of odd or C program to check palindrome without using string functions. Some palindrome strings are: "C", "CC"...
A palindrome is one such string related python problem that almost all the computer science student try to solve in order to learn how python strings work. A palindrome is a string that reads the same forwards and backward. A very simple solution for checking palindrome using python string indexing method
Write a recursive function that computes and returns the sum of all elements in an array, where the array and its size are given as parameters. //return the sum of all elements in a[] int findsum(int a[], int n) Write a recursive function that determines whether an array is a palindrome, where the array and its size are given as parameters.
The palindrome is set to be a number whose reverse is said to be equal. In this program, we will be using if and while statement. If the given condition placed in “if ” statement is true then it is a palindrome else it is not.
Recursive data structures and recursive functions go together like bread and butter. The recursive function’s structure can often be modeled after the definition of the recursive data structure it takes as an input. Let me demonstrate this by calculating the sum of all the elements of a list recursively:
Apr 15, 2017 · Base Case For Recursive Solution : if l > h (we crossed pointers) return INT_MAX; if l == h return 0; (only one character, which is already palindrome, 0 insertion is required to make it palindrome) if l == h-1 and if str[l] == str[h] return 0;
C program to check whether a string is a palindrome or not – In this article, we will detail in on the multiple ways to check whether a string is a palindrome or not in C programming. Suitable examples and sample programs have also been added so that you can understand the whole thing very clearly.
